Reginae’s post didn’t come with a #ad. The disclaimer doesn’t appear necessary when the promotional agenda is clear – here, Carter mentioning she is a SavagexFenty ambassador does it. Pay on Instagram correlates directly with following, something that experts over at Vox have thrown out suggested figures for.
“Influencers with up to 1 million followers can get $10,000 [per post], depending on the platform, and 1 million followers and up, you’re getting into territory where they can charge $100,000. Some can even get $250,000 for a post.”
